Trump set to deliver joint address to Congress

President Trump is set to give a joint address to Congress tomorrow .

He's expected to tout what he believes are his early second term successes.

After the speech, he's set to stay in Washington and amplify his message from the White House .

Vice President JD Vance , however, is expected to take his place to highlight the administration's message on the road.

The Hill 's White House correspondent for The Hill, Alex Ganjitano , says the president's speech likely to be domestically focused.

He says there will be a lot of him saying I put America first .

The Hill correspondent says that could be a flashpoint for the president with Republicans .
